>> In order to support multiple primary interrupt controllers in the same
>> image, it is necessary to use the MULTI_IRQ_HANDLER config option.
>>
>> This patch series makes a first step in that direction by:
>> - having the GIC code to provides a global handler,
>> - make GIC users to provide this handler from their machine descriptor.
>>
>> A side effect of this is that it forces OMAP2/3 platforms to be
>> converted too in order to preserve the MULTI_OMAP feature. This leads
>> to a certain simplification of the interrupt handling for the
>> OMAP2/3/4 platforms.
>>
>> The primary IRQ handlers have been written in C, and the performance
>> degradation is hardly noticeable. Should some tests reveal a major
>> increase in latency, it is always possible to restore the ASM version.
>>
>> This series has been tested on VE (A9, A5, A15), PB11MP, Panda, IGEPv2
>> and Harmony. Patches against next-20110926 plus my PPI series.
